Why is the Green clean light blinking on my Kenmore dishwasher?

The blinking clean light normally indicates that the control on the dishwasher detected a problem with the heating circuit. The dishwasher will step through a short (10 minute) test cycle and then the control will be reset. You can cancel the cycle at any time after it is started by pressing the CANCEL button.

What does clean light on dishwasher mean?

The Clean light is an indication that the dishwasher has been run and the dishes inside it are clean. Once the door is opened after the cycle is complete, the light will shut off.

How do I clear the error code on my Kenmore Elite dishwasher?

In order to reset this model of Kenmore dishwasher, press on the two outer buttons at the same time and hold down for three seconds. Then, close the dishwasher and latch the door. This will start the short test cycle and reset the machine.

How do you turn off the flashing light on a Kenmore?

Pressing the buttons on the panel in order and within 5 seconds resets the control panel and turns off the flashing light. The buttons must be pressed in the following order: “Heated Dry,” “Normal Wash,” “Heated Dry” and “Normal Wash.”
